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Work
If staring at a blank message box makes you hesitate, try these low-pressure, adaptable openers that invite a reply without sounding generic or intense.
Quick opener patterns to copy and tweak
- Profile hook + light question: "I see you love hiking—what's one trail you'd recommend for someone who likes good views but hates mosquitoes?"
- Observation + playful choice: "You have coffee pics and concert photos—team morning latte or team live music?"
- Micro-compliment + follow-up: "Nice travel photos—which trip was the most surprising?"
- Shared-interest prompt: "We both like [band/food/show]. What's a song/dish/episode I have to check out?"
- Contextual curiosity: "Your dog looks like a mischief maker—what's the funniest thing they've done?"
How to avoid sounding bland or forced
- Skip generic lines. Instead of "Hey" or "How are you?" use a specific detail from their profile to show you looked.
- Don’t over-praise. A simple compliment tied to a question feels natural: one sentence, then a prompt for them to respond.
- Keep it light. First messages should invite conversation, not interrogate—avoid heavy topics or long lists of questions.
- Personalize quickly. Even swapping one detail (city, hobby, pet) turns a template into something that feels tailored.
Small techniques that make replies more likely
- Offer two easy choices. "Which would you pick: beach day or city museum?" is easier to answer than an open-ended question.
- Use a short, friendly callback. If they mentioned a recent trip in their profile, mention that trip again later in the conversation to show attention.
- Keep messages scannable. One or two short sentences are better than a paragraph for a first message.
- End with a soft prompt. Phrases like "Curious what you think" or "Which would you pick?" invite a simple reply.
Examples You Can Make Your Own
- "Your hiking photo looks epic—what trail was that? I’m trying to add more weekend hikes."
- "I noticed you cook—what's your signature dish? I might need a recommendation."
- "You mentioned podcasts—what's one episode that stuck with you?"
- "Cat or dog person? (I have strong opinions but will hear you out.)"
Start small, stay curious, and tailor one detail. A thoughtful, brief opener shows you paid attention and makes it easy for the other person to reply—no scripts, just better starts. - Mingle2
